Breaking Down the Features of Labconco Explosion-Proof Blowers for Explosion-Proof Laboratory Hoods, Labconco 7069300 Coated Steel Explosion-Proof Blowers
Specifications
- Inlet Size: 31.1 cm (12 1/4 inches) O.D. This large inlet size allows for efficient fume capture.
- Outlet Size: 17.8 cm D x 34.3 cm W (7 x 13 1/2 inches). The rectangular outlet provides flexibility in ductwork connections.
- Horsepower: 3/4 HP. This provides ample power for most laboratory fume hood applications.
- Airflow: 1305 CFM at 0.38 inches H2O to 1200 CFM at 0.88 inches H2O. The airflow rating is critical for ensuring proper fume hood performance and worker safety.
- Electrical: 115/230V, 60Hz, 11.4/5.7A. The dual voltage capability adds to the blower’s versatility.
- Coated Steel Housing: Provides corrosion resistance in moderately corrosive environments.
- Non-Sparking Aluminum Impeller: Essential for preventing ignition of flammable vapors.
- Explosion-Proof Motor: A crucial safety feature in environments where explosive vapors may be present.
- Adjustable Sheaves: Allow for fine-tuning of airflow to meet specific application requirements.
- Dry Powder Epoxy-Coated Base and Weather Cover: Provides protection against extreme weather conditions.
- Self-Adjusting Gravity Belt Tightener: Ensures consistent performance by maintaining proper belt tension.
- UL Listed Motor: Confirms that the motor meets stringent safety standards.
These specifications are crucial because they directly impact the blower’s ability to safely and effectively remove hazardous fumes from the laboratory environment. The explosion-proof motor and non-sparking impeller are non-negotiable safety features in any lab handling flammable materials.
